Chief Architect’s core workflow revolves around parametric building objects such as walls, doors, windows, and cabinets, so plan changes update the 3D representation without manual rework. The toolset includes automated roof generation, terrain modeling, and section or elevation view generation from the model state. It also includes rendering and 3D export options for sharing designs outside drafting mode. A major fit signal is that it targets architectural documentation outputs rather than generic polygon modeling.

Chief Architect can be less convenient when the deliverable is a highly customized mesh or a downstream BIM pipeline that expects strict schema mapping. The model-to-export path tends to be strongest for visualization and architectural review rather than round-tripping with heavy BIM authoring tools. It fits situations where iterative edits and documentation consistency matter more than interchange fidelity. It also fits when a team needs predictable layout outputs like schedules, callouts, and annotated graphics from one project file.

Planner 5D is most useful when plans need to move from 2D room layouts into a usable 3D view for stakeholder review. The workflow supports snapping and dimension tools for basic geometry accuracy, and it provides a large library of furniture and room elements for layout composition. 3D views can be reviewed through a walkthrough camera, and layouts can be exported to external viewers for comments.

A tradeoff appears in schematic rigor for large, multi-discipline projects, because Planner 5D is not positioned as a full BIM authoring environment. Teams that need high-fidelity IFC compliance or strict CAD layer discipline will hit friction when translating requirements into its modeling objects. It fits usage where a designer produces concept layouts, explores options, and exports shareable scenes for quick feedback cycles.

HomeByMe centers on drafting a room layout in 2D and then switching to a 3D perspective that updates as walls, openings, and furniture placement change. The tool includes a library approach for furnishings and finishes and includes walkthrough-oriented navigation for spatial checking. It also supports sharing a project view for client review without requiring separate CAD software.

A key tradeoff is that HomeByMe’s modeling depth is focused on design visualization rather than construction-grade parametric assemblies or IFC-centric BIM interchange. It fits scenarios like apartment redesign, furniture planning, and client walkthrough reviews where the goal is faster concept iteration than documentation accuracy.

AutoCAD Architecture is a DWG-first floor plan and 3D modeling option built for drafting workflows, with parametric building elements like walls, doors, and windows that still behave like CAD objects. It supports section view generation, elevation callouts, and dimension annotation tools while maintaining control of layer and block-based plan detailing.

For 3D review, it can produce 3D walkthrough export and export formats like OBJ and glTF for downstream visualization. In practice, its main strength is tight DWG interoperability with consistent drafting conventions rather than a BIM-native data model.

Floorplanner lets users draft room layouts in a browser and then view them in 3D for fast spatial review. It supports drag-and-drop floor plan creation with adjustable walls, doors, and windows, plus furniture placement using a built-in symbol library.

The workflow emphasizes quick iteration and presentation outputs like 3D views and walkthrough-style navigation. The core value comes from shortening the edit-to-visual-check loop for layout and furnishing decisions.

Sweet Home 3D targets room layout and quick 3D visualization for smaller projects where full BIM workflows are not required. It supports browser-based drafting of a 2D plan with an interactive 3D view, plus furniture placement using a symbol library.

The tool exports 3D output through common interchange formats and includes basic drawing tools for room shapes and elevation-style views. Compared with SketchUp, Revit, and ArchiCAD, it delivers faster modeling for interiors but provides less governance and fewer automation surfaces for multi-user production.

Live Home 3D is a floor plan 3D tool built around fast interior and site layouts with direct room modeling and live visualization. The workflow centers on drawing walls, adding parametric furnishings, and generating 3D views for walkthrough-style inspection.

Exports cover 3D formats such as OBJ and glTF, plus common 2D plan outputs for handoff. The software favors practical layout editing over full BIM authoring and deep interoperability with architectural CAD models.

Space Designer 3D is a browser-based floor plan 3D modeling tool that focuses on fast room layout and visual review. It provides a 2D drafting workflow with push-pull 3D view creation, plus walkthrough-style navigation and exportable 3D models.

The tool’s material and lighting controls support photorealistic rendering passes for client-ready stills and simple 3D presentation assets. It also supports DWG import and layered drawing organization so existing CAD floor plan geometry can be used as a starting point.
